SAUK CENTRE -- A Cokato woman is facing drug charges after being busted with methamphetamine during a traffic stop in Stearns County.

At around 10:15 last Thursday night a Sheriff's Deputy noticed a vehicle without tail lights heading east on I-94, in Sauk Centre Township.

While doing the traffic stop, the driver of the car, 39-year-old Richard Braun of Inver Grove Heights asked to look at the tail lights, which the deputy allowed. When he exited the vehicle, the deputy saw a small pipe on the driver's seat.

The deputy brought his Police Dog Jax to conduct a search of the car. While searching, Jax focused on a purse in the car that belonged to Braun's passenger, 50-year-old Janet Felcyn.

Inside the purse, authorities found 18 grams of meth and $3,800 in cash. Felcyn, who had an active warrant from Washington County was taken to Stearns County Jail on 3rd Degree Controlled Substance charges, Braun was cited and released.
